What are you doing to expand your mind and achieve more with your life?

As a success coach and leader I often ask this question to the people I work with.  For me it’s the stimulus of challenge that causes me to grow, and I think we’re wired like that as human beings.  For instance;

  • When I want to be stronger, I stretch my muscles.
  • When I want to have more confidence in the future, I stretch my faith.
  • When I want to enjoy financial rewards, I put my money to work.
  • When I want to grow, I stretch my mind with challenging paradigms.

In this past week I have attended one Conference and one workshop.  Both of these events cost me financially to attend and required a sacrifice of time to be there.  But that investment also provided me a return – and that return was an expanded mind.
